What is the plural of gradualism?

What's the plural form of gradualism? Here's the word you're looking for.

Answer

The noun gradualism can be countable or uncountable.

In more general, commonly used, contexts, the plural form will also be gradualism.

However, in more specific contexts, the plural form can also be gradualisms e.g. in reference to various types of gradualisms or a collection of gradualisms.
